Pakistan Welcomes Long-Awaited Ceasefire in Gaza

Islamabad: Prime Minister of Pakistan, Muhammad Shehbaz Sharif, on Thursday welcomed the announcement of the long-awaited ceasefire in Gaza.

According to Qatar News Agency, Sharif appreciated the efforts made by the deal mediators to enhance security and peace in the region, urging full respect and implementation of the agreement. He reiterated Pakistan's support for a two-state solution in line with relevant UN resolutions, advocating for the establishment of an independent Palestinian state with pre-1967 borders and Al Quds as its capital.

The ceasefire agreement, achieved through joint mediation efforts by the State of Qatar, in collaboration with Egypt and the United States, involves an agreement between the Palestinian Islamic Resistance Movement (Hamas) and Israel. The ceasefire will be accompanied by an exchange of prisoners and detainees, and is set to take effect next Sunday.
